North Little Rock girl located safe, man in custody after Amber Alert

The Pulaski County Sheriff's Office says the 4-year-old girl was located safe, and Brodrick Hardman is in custody. He was wanted for first-degree murder.

NORTH LITTLE ROCK, Ark. — The search for a 4-year-old North Little Rock girl is over.

According to the Pulaski County Sheriff's Office, the girl was located safely and uninjured on Friday, and Brodrick Hardman, 44, is in custody.

Eastern Arkansas Fugitive Task Force members found Hardman and the girl around 3:30 p.m. at a residence near East Washington Avenue in North Little Rock.

The North Little Rock Police Department issued an Amber Alert for the 4-year-old girl Thursday and said she left with Hardman, her great uncle.

Shortly after, the Pulaski County Sheriff's Office issued a BOLO alert for Hardman, who had an arrest warrant for first-degree murder.

Hardman was developed as a suspect after deputies found Kijuan Comic, 38, dead in the 4100 block of East 37th Street in College Station on July 12.

He is being held at the Pulaski County Regional Detention Facility without bond.
